πρωτόπλους

First/Second declension Adjective; Transliteration:

Principal Part: πρωτόπλους πρωτόπλουν

Structure: πρωτοπλο (Stem) + ος (Ending)

Sense

  1. going to sea for the first time, firstplied
  2. sailing first or foremost

Examples

  • παραγγείλασ δὲ τοῖσ πρωτόπλοισ τῶν μεθ’ αὑτοῦ μὴ ἐμβαλεῖν ταῖσ ὑστάταισ, ἐδίωκε τὰσ προεχούσασ. (Xenophon, Hellenica, , chapter 1 34:5)

Source: Henry George Liddell. Robert Scott. "A Greek-English Lexicon". revised and augmented throughout by. Sir Henry Stuart Jones.
